Terraforma 2019

A report from the experimental music festival in Milan.

A three days round experience, a journey outside of our day-to-day enclosures in a hectic and workaholic city as Milan. Wandering into an entirely different realm and a more organic way of partying in the unblemished heaven of nature of Villa Arconati, a unique place with lush scenery, labyrinths, magical gardens and futuristic stages and structures designed by the Italian architect Matteo Petrucci.
